Clarity Control of Character Printing in PCB Manufacturing

In PCB manufacturing, the clarity of character printing directly affects production traceability, assembly efficiency and product reliability. The following systematically expounds on how to control the clarity of characters from aspects such as design specifications, process parameters, material selection and detection methods:

First, design specification control

Character size standard

Minimum line width and spacing: The character line width is recommended to be ≥0.15mm (6mil), and the character height should be ≥0.8mm to ensure recognition by both human eyes and machine vision.

Safe distance from the solder pad: The distance between the characters and the edge of the solder pad should be ≥0.2mm to prevent the carbonization of the character ink due to heat during welding and the contamination of the solder joint.

Font and layout optimization

Recommended fonts: Use equal-width sans-serif fonts (such as OCR-B, Helvetica), and avoid italic or decorative fonts that may cause character distortion.

Layout principles:

Key information (such as component position numbers) is close to the corresponding pads to reduce the visual search time;

Polarity markings (such as diodes, electrolytic capacitors) should be kept at a distance of ≥0.5mm from the component profile to prevent assembly misoperation.

Color and Contrast

Mainstream color combinations:

White characters (solder mask window) + green substrate (contrast >70%)

Black characters (covered with solder mask) + white substrate (contrast >85%)

Avoid low-contrast designs: For instance, light yellow characters printed on light green substrates may lead to misjudgment in AOI detection.

Second, process parameter control

Screen printing parameters

Web version parameters:

Mesh size: 325-400 mesh (applicable to character height 0.8-1.2mm)

Emulsion thickness: 10-15μm, ensuring uniform ink penetration.

Printing parameters:

Scraper Angle: 70°-75°, pressure 0.2-0.3MPa, speed 100-150mm/s, to prevent burrs on the edges of characters.

Ink selection and curing

Ink type:

Thermocuring type: Suitable for single-sided panels, curing temperature 150℃×30 minutes;

UV curing type: Suitable for double-sided or multi-layer boards, with a curing energy of 800-1200mJ/cm².

Performance requirements:

Adhesion: 100-grid test ≥4B (ASTM D3359);

Solvent resistance: No peeling after 50 wiping with isopropyl alcohol (IPC-SM-840E).

Direct imaging Technology (DI

High-precision inkjet: Utilizing piezoelectric nozzles, with a resolution of ≥1200dpi and a minimum character height of 0.3mm, it is suitable for high-density boards.

Multi-color printing: Supports 4-color (CMYK) or spot color printing to meet personalized needs such as brand logos.

Third, process quality control

First item inspection

Inspection items: Character integrity, position deviation (≤±0.1mm), color consistency (ΔE≤3).

Tools: Use a 3D microscope to measure the height of characters and a colorimeter to detect the Lab* value.

Online monitoring

AOI inspection

Character recognition rate ≥99.5%;

Defect classification: Missing pen, broken line, offset, ink accumulation.

Data traceability: Record the printing parameters and inspection results of each board, and generate SPC charts to monitor process stability.

Environmental control

Temperature and humidity: The temperature in the printing workshop is 23±2℃, and the humidity is 50±10% to prevent the characters from becoming blurred due to changes in ink viscosity.

Cleanliness: ISO level 7 (10,000 level) or above to avoid surface defects of characters caused by dust adhesion.

Fourth, industry trends and Best practices

Automation and Intelligence

Integrate the MES system to achieve real-time linkage between printing parameters and inspection data. For instance, automatically adjust the scraper pressure when character defects are detected.

Environmental protection requirements

Promote water-based inks or UV LED curing technology to reduce VOC emissions and comply with RoHS and REACH regulations.

Enhanced traceability

Superimpose QR codes or Data Matrix codes on the character layer to support full life cycle traceability, and the code size is ≥1.0mm×1.0mm.

Through strict design specifications, meticulous process control and intelligent detection methods, it can be ensured that the clarity of PCB character printing reaches the industry high standards (such as IPC-A-600H Class 2/3), meeting the demands of high-end fields such as automotive electronics and medical equipment.
